About this earthquake

On February 28, 2026 at 18:58 UTC, a magnitude M1.7 earthquake occurred near Periphereiake Enoteta Zakynthou, Periphereia Ionion Neson (Greece). With a focal depth of about 23 km, this was a shallow earthquake, whose shaking is usually felt more strongly at the surface. Events of this size typically go unnoticed.

The event was recorded by NOA. Greece: 94 earthquakes were recorded in the past 24 hours, the strongest reaching M3.0.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
